WebThe life line is one of the five main lines read in palmistry. It extends around the thumb. The life line is usually in an arc around the base of the thumb, starting between the index finger and the thumb and ending near the wrist.. In palm reading, the length of the life line has no relationship with how long one could live.It reflects one's health and physical vitality. WebReading the Primary Lines of your Hand 1.
